Crosswell's Cardiff Brewery Ltd black backed tray dating from the late 1920s.
The firm was originally founded as an agent for Showell & Co. Ltd, based in the West Midlands.
The Company sold Showell's beers in South Wales.
The Company was registered as Crosswell's Cardiff Brewery Ltd in 1897, to amalgamate the businesses of the Caerphilly & Castle Brewery Co. Ltd and Crosswell's Ltd.
The Company was acquired by Andrew Buchan's Breweries Ltd of Rhymney in 1938, and brewing ceased in 1947.
Andrew Buchan's Breweries Ltd operated Crosswell's brewery for bottling its beers until 1958, when it was closed, and subsequently demolished.
The manufacturer's mark states - Hancock Corfield & Waller Ltd Mitcham London Underneath the maker's mark is - 1'5M.28.F.FT
